$image = file_get_contents($_FILES['image']['tmp_name']);
$image = mysql_real_escape_string($image);
mysql_query("UPDATE ngc set pic='" . $image "' WHERE username='" . $_SESSION["username"] . "'");
<form method="post" action="" enctype="multipart/form-data">
Upload Image :<input type="file" name="image" id="file">
<br><input type="submit" name="submit" value="Update!" class="btnSubmit">
</form>
我想将图像上传到数据库。
在此处阅读这个非常不错的示例:http : //www.mysqltutorial.org/php-mysql-blob/在此处也请参见此图库示例:http : //www.anyexample.com/programming/php/php_mysql_example__image_gallery_(blob_storage)。 XML文件
BLOB是MySql数据库中的数据类型,可以帮助您将图像文件直接存储在数据库中。
尽管更好的方法是将文件存储在磁盘上并将该变量的路径存储在数据库中。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句